2

私はscalaが初めてで、Windowsで笑顔を使おうとしています。シェルは使用できますが、.bat-script から smile を実行できません。私は次のように書いています。

::#!
@echo off
call scala %0 %*
goto :eof
::!#

println("Hello, Welcome to Scala Script.....!!!!!")

import smile._

スクリプトをあらゆる種類の場所に配置しようとしましたが、次のエラーが継続的に発生します。

scala> import smile._

:12: エラー: 見つかりません: 値の笑顔

import smile._

ディレクトリ構造がどうあるべきかわかりません (つまり、.bat ファイルをダウンロードしたファイルに対してどこに配置すればよいでしょうか。ソース ファイルとコンパイル済みバージョンのどちらを使用する必要がありますか?

4

1 に答える 1

1

scala スクリプトがサードパーティのライブラリを使用する必要がある場合は、次のようにする必要があります。

scala -classpath third_party.jar test.scala

したがって、スクリプトを次のように変更する必要がある場合があります。

::#!
@echo off
call scala -classpath your_smile.jar %0 %*
goto :eof
::!#

println("Hello, Welcome to Scala Script.....!!!!!")
import smile._
于 2016-10-19T09:45:02.257 に答える